Noun[edit]

ฟ้อง (fɔ́ɔng)

  1. (law) document instituting legal proceedings: plaint, complaint, charge, petition, etc.

Verb[edit]

ฟ้อง (fɔ́ɔng) (abstract noun การฟ้อง)

  1. (law) to sue; to institute or subject to (legal proceedings), as by a plaint, complaint, charge, petition, etc.
  2. to complain; to claim; to allege; to accuse; to denounce.
  3. to indicate; to show; to tell.
